We can solve this equation by using the systems of equations.
We can do this by subtracting like terms from both equations using substitution.
First, let's find the value of y:
6x + 3y = 21
3y = -6x + 21
y = -2x + 7
Then, we should plug it into one of the equations:
3x - 7y = 2
3x - 7(-2x + 7) = 2
3x + 14x - 49 = 2
17x = 51
x = 3
Now, we solve for y by plugging the value of x into the equation:
3x - 7y = 2
3(3) - 7y = 2
9 - 7y = 2
-7y = -7
7y = 7
y = 1

Answer: 21.21 meters
Step-by-step explanation:
Hi, to answer this, first we have to calculate the circumference (C) of the wheel:
C = π x diameter
Replacing with the values given:
C = π x 45 = 141.37 cm
Then we multiply it by the number of revolutions:
141.37 x 15 = 2,120.6 cm
Since
1 cm = 0.01 m
2,120.6 x 0.01 = 21.21 meters
